Julien Lavergne (gilir) wrote :

I pushed a potential fix to the seed. I hope it will be enough.

Apparently, grub is put on flavors ISO just by the recommend of Ubiquity.
See : http://people.canonical.com/~ubuntu-archive/germinate-output/xubuntu.zesty/live
And : http://people.canonical.com/~ubuntu-archive/germinate-output/ubuntu.zesty/live

Since lubuntu uses no-follow-recommends, we miss this one, so I put it explicitly on the seed.
